Features Included with Most VoIP Services

VoIP Features

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) technology has changed the way the world communicates like no other invention since the telephone was invented by Alexander Graham Bell in 1876. The use of VoIP does far more than to  provide users with free long distance calling. Modern VoIP service comes complete with a large array of advanced features that can rarely be matched by traditional telephone service.

VoIP not only offers the same features as a traditional telephone company, but also provides consumers with a host of features that can only be powered by a digital medium, such as VoIP. The advanced features offered by VoIP have helped pave the way for the next generation of communications technology. Let's analyze some of the features that are available with VoIP service.
